Main features and details
Online casinos employ several features to enhance accessibility for users. One of the most significant is the development of responsive websites and mobile applications that allow players to gamble on various devices, including smartphones and tablets. This flexibility ensures that users can access their favorite games anytime and anywhere.
- User-friendly interfaces: Many online casinos prioritize intuitive design, making it easier for players of all ages and technical abilities to navigate their platforms.
- Game variety: Online casinos offer a wide range of games, including slots, table games, and live dealer options, catering to different preferences and skill levels.
- Support for multiple languages: Many platforms provide multilingual support, ensuring that players from diverse backgrounds can enjoy the experience without language barriers.
- Accessibility features: Some online casinos incorporate features such as screen readers and adjustable text sizes to assist players with visual impairments.
Practical examples and use cases
Real-world usage scenarios illustrate how online casinos enhance accessibility. For instance, a player with mobility issues can easily access a casino website from home without the need to travel to a physical location. Additionally, individuals who may feel uncomfortable in traditional gambling environments can participate in online gaming from a safe and familiar setting.
Another example includes the rise of social gaming platforms that allow users to engage with friends and family while playing. This social aspect can be particularly appealing to younger audiences and those looking for a more interactive experience.
